I don’t do premix for margs because I make amazing margs from scratch that all my friend rave about. I recently tried throwing it in the Slushi even though I’m typically an on the rocks gal.

Recipe: 1 cup Tequila (I prefer silver for margs, something decent)

1/2 cup triple sec

1/2 cup sugar

1/2 to 1 cup lime juice (to taste) - I like to fresh squeeze but I’ll use the Real Lime bottle from the juice aisle when I’m lazy.

1 bottle Minute Maid lemonade, the zero sugar one. I try to keep my sugar intake somewhat low and even if you use a sugared lemonade you’ll still need to sweeten it unless you like super sour margs. This also replaces the sour mix and makes for a smoother marg in all mine and my friends’ opinions.

This will keep in the fridge so you can mix ahead of time. That recipe fits pretty much perfectly in the 64oz slushi machine too.

If you really want to prep for a party, slushing it and putting it in a yeti pitcher and then in the fridge will keep it the perfect consistency overnight to start drinking while you’re waiting for the machine to slush for the party.

Outfitting my boat.... Shopping List... What am I forgetting? by Beregond17 in offshorefishing

[–]whatjess 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Ignore the 1 per person life jacket rule and buy them this way:

Children - comfortable, appropriately fitting jackets that they wear 100% of the time. (If you have kids)

Adults with fear of water - have 1-2 comfortable one fits most like the kind you’d wear on a jet ski.

Then buy one of the coast guard approved bag/package of life jackets that are stored somewhere easily accessible but MAKE SURE TO GET AS MANY AS PEOPLE YOUR BOAT HOLDS.

Boom now you never have to worry about not having enough life jackets and getting stopped by coast guard.
